UPDATED: Former WWE Superstar Brodus Clay accused of sexual misconduct

Former WWE and Impact Superstar Brodus Clay/Tyrus has been accused of sexual misconduct by his co-host on the FOX Nation show “Un-PC”. The Daily Beast reports that Tyrus’ co-host Britt McHenry complained about Tyrus’ sexual misconduct to the powers that be within the FOX management.

 


 

According to the report, the former WWE Superstar sent McHenry unwanted text messages that were lewd and sexual. After the filing of these complaints, Tyrus was taken off from Un-PC and moved to a brand new show called “NUFFSAID”.

Several other sources who’ve worked with the former WWE Superstar suggested that this complaint wasn’t surprising and that the former Funkasauras has an unconventional and “wild” sense of humour.

A FOX spokesperson has reached out to us regarding this situation and provided us with the following statement:

While we are not at liberty to discuss the details of any employee matter, we follow strict protocols when matters such as these are brought to our attention, and we make no exceptions. The process works because of the extensive systems and measures we have instituted. This situation was independently investigated and we consider the matter resolved. We respect the confidentiality of all involved.
